      I live in the woods, and while tinnitus had something to do with that decision, the reality is that I am a creature of the pine forest, I grew up in the woods, and I was just never going to be happy or content or calm in a fast-paced urban environment.

      I actually think that cities (and to a lesser degree, suburban areas) are bad for everyone. Noise and light pollution are stressors at a cellular level, and the more people and cars you're around, the more petrol fumes and heavy metals and toxins you're inhaling and ingesting.

      I get that not everyone wants to live where I do, though -- I have to drive 25 minutes for a movie theater, 40 minutes for a walmart. But, I hate walmart anyway, and the advantage is that I can walk 15 feet out my back door and be in a forest.
